Introduction
Wilhelmus C Roovers is a notable inventor based in Prinsenbeek, Netherlands. He has made significant contributions to the field of continuously variable transmissions, holding a total of six patents. His work focuses on improving the efficiency and performance of transmission systems, particularly in motor vehicles.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ents involves a continuously variable transmission designed to maintain a constant transmission ratio under various operating conditions. This innovation is particularly beneficial for navigating bends, inclines, emergency stops, and during transmission overspeeding. The design ensures that the input revolutions per minute (r.p.m.) of the transmission can change while keeping the transmission ratio stable. Another patent focuses on a continuously variable transmission that features a control system for adjusting the transmission ratio based on input signals. This system enhances the drive characteristics and efficiency of the transmission, providing optimal power delivery.
Career Highlights
Wilhelmus C Roovers is associated with Van Doorne's Transmissie B.V., a company known for its advancements in transmission technology. His work has contributed to the development of innovative solutions that improve vehicle performance and efficiency.
Collaborations
He has collaborated with notable coworkers such as Chi Chung Choi and Emery F Hendriks, who have also contributed to advancements in transmission technology.
